WebPrentice's rule, named so after the optician Charles F. Prentice, is a formula used to determine the amount of induced prism in a lens: [3] where: P is the amount of prism correction (in prism dioptres) c is decentration (the distance between the pupil centre and the lens's optical centre, in millimetres) f is lens power (in dioptres)

Web26 aug. 2024 · Charles F. Prentice (an optician!) developed a formula to determine the amount of induced prism in a lens. Your one job is to know Prentice’s rule equation well! Prentice’s rule determines how much deviation is present when one looks away from the optical center of a given lens. There is no prismatic power at the optical center of the lens.
